Fortinet

FortiEDR is a endpoint detection and response platform with automated threat prevention, real-time detection and incident response capabilities. By integrating FortiEDR with Nozomi Vantage, security teams gain a consolidated view of managed assets across IT and OT environments — importing endpoint detection and protection telemetry directly into Vantage. This enriches the asset registry with authoritative data from the FortiNet management plane, accelerating incident investigation, reducing blind spots in critical infrastructure environments and enabling analysts to correlate edr xdr telemetry with OT network observations without switching consoles.

Features

Importer Data Types

Vantage imports the following from
FortiEDR
:
  • Asset Details Enrichment and Create New in Vantage

    FortiEDR supplies records including collector hostname, IP and MAC addresses, OS and kernel version, collector group, policy assignment, isolation state and last-communication timestamp — to enrich existing Vantage assets and create new asset records for endpoints not yet observed on the OT network.

Joint Use Cases

  • Correlating Fortinet signals with OT network alerts

    When Nozomi Vantage raises an anomaly alert for a device inside an OT segment, the analyst can pivot to the same asset's FortiEDR record in Vantage to review recent detections, prevention events, isolation status and agent health, all without leaving the Vantage investigation workflow. This cross-layer correlation surfaces whether a network-layer anomaly coincides with activity observed by FortiNet, reducing the time needed to confirm or dismiss an incident.

  • Closing asset inventory gaps across IT and OT

    Devices recorded by FortiEDR but not yet observed by Nozomi network sensors are automatically created as new asset records in Vantage, populated with hostname, OS, agent status and last-seen timestamp drawn from the FortiNet management plane. OT operations teams can audit the resulting unified inventory to identify unmonitored or underprotected assets in industrial and critical infrastructure zones, then prioritize sensor deployment accordingly.

  • Validating asset-management coverage across IT and OT

    Records from FortiEDR are reconciled with Vantage's network-observed inventory, surfacing assets that are present in one source but missing from the other.

Integration Prerequesites

  • Active Nozomi Vantage tenant with the connector-configuration role assigned to the administering account
  • FortiEDR Central Manager with an API user account granted read access to the Inventory collection
  • Consistent hostname, IP or MAC addressing between FortiEDR-recorded assets and Vantage-observed assets to enable accurate asset correlation and deduplication
  • Outbound network connectivity from Vantage to the source-tool API endpoint over HTTPS (this prerequisite is a deployment placeholder and may be adjusted to match your environment)
